Abstract:
In Fiber-Optics communication network pulse broadening due to chromatic dispersion becomes an important factor for signal quality degradation. This may become worse when we increase the data transmission rate. So in order to achieve high data transmission rate at long distance light wave system, the chromatic dispersion in the fiber must be compensated. Many compensation techniques have been studied and they show a variety of different and often complimentary properties. Transmitter compensation techniques are the most easily implemented tecnique. The most commercially advanced technique is negative dispersion fiber. We discuss the design of a Wavelength Division Multiplexed system (WDM) with dispersion compensation fiber (DCF). The result of both pre- compensation and post -compensation techniques has also been discussed. The bit error rate (BER) of the system under two different modulation schemes is also discussed.
